[Remote] System Manager Payer Analytics Economics
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. CommonSpirit Health is one of the nation’s largest nonprofit Catholic healthcare organizations, delivering integrated health services. The System Manager, Payer will provide strategic leadership for payer relations and contracting, managing a team to negotiate and monitor contracts with health plans.
Responsibilities
• Manage the labor and operations of the Payer Analytics & Economics team including the hiring, orienting, developing and managing of staff
• Oversee quality control and quality assurance of Payer Analytics & Economics analytics deliverables and financial models to support the negotiation and implementation of appropriate reimbursement rates associated language, between physicians/hospitals and payers/networks for managed care contracting initiatives
• Review and accurately interpret contract terms, including payer policies and procedures to appropriately contract performance and influence strategic pricing strategies
• Monitor contract financial performance. Analyze and publish managed care performance statements and determine profitability
• Provide training and oversight of the modeling of proposed/existing payer contracts negotiated by payer strategy and operations, including expected and actual revenues/volumes, past performance, proposed contract language and regulatory changes
• Oversee and prepare complex service line reimbursement analyses and financial performance analyses. Develop methods and models (involving multiple variables and assumptions) to identify the implications/ramifications/results of a wide variety of new/revised strategies, approaches, provisions, parameters and rate structures aimed at establishing appropriate reimbursement levels. Prepare and effectively present results to senior leadership, and other key stakeholders, for review and decision making activities
Skills
• Bachelors Other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ration, Accounting, Finance, Healthcare or related field. or Equivalent education and experience in related field(s) may be considered in lieu of degree
• Five (5) years of experience in contributing to profitability through detailed financial analysis and efficient delivery of data management strategies supporting contract analysis, trend management, budgeting, forecasting, strategic planning in the healthcare industry
• Two (2) years of experience in a supervisory role
• Requires some experience with SQL queries and Excel
• Strongly prefer hospital or managed care experience
• EPIC experience a big plus
